Contract Recruiter
Location Boston, MA 2110 Date Posted September 15, 2026 Job ID 15534 Employment Type Contract Pay rate $56/hour
Scion Nonprofit Staffing has been engaged to conduct a search for a Contract Recruiter for a highly respected, mission-driven nonprofit organization serving its local community through philanthropy, grantmaking, programs, and strategic partnerships. This is a 3-month temporary opportunity with potential to extend based on organizational need and is hybrid in Boston, MA, with onsite work required Tuesdays and Wednesdays.
POSITION OVERVIEW:
The Contract Recruiter will provide immediate recruiting support by taking ownership of multiple active professional-level searches across a diverse range of functions. This individual will manage the full recruiting lifecycle, partnering closely with hiring managers to develop recruiting strategies, source and engage qualified talent, conduct candidate screenings, coordinate interviews, and maintain strong candidate pipelines. The ideal candidate is a resourceful, relationship-driven recruiter who can quickly step into an active workload and independently move searches forward in a professional, mission-driven environment.

RESPONSIBILITIES:
Own full-cycle recruitment for multiple professional-level searches, from initial sourcing and candidate engagement through interview coordination, offer support, and handoff to onboarding.
Immediately take ownership of approximately 4-5 active searches, developing recruiting strategies and building qualified candidate pipelines.
Recruit across professional functions including research and evaluation, HR, development/fundraising, finance, operations, IT, marketing, strategy, programs, events, and grantmaking.
Partner with hiring managers to understand position requirements, translate needs into effective sourcing strategies, and develop thoughtful interview and candidate evaluation processes.
Source, screen, engage, and manage candidates while providing consistent communication and a high-quality candidate experience throughout the recruiting process.
Maintain accurate recruiting activity within the ATS and leverage modern recruiting and AI tools to increase efficiency, strengthen search execution, and continuously improve recruiting processes.
QUALIFICATIONS:
Demonstrated success managing end-to-end, full-cycle recruitment for professional and primarily exempt-level positions.
Direct experience recruiting for professional-services positions such as Director of Research, HR Generalist, Development/Fundraising, and other specialized corporate or nonprofit functions.
Ability to independently manage multiple active searches, prioritize urgent hiring needs, and move quickly from high-level hiring-manager direction to active candidate outreach.
Strong sourcing, screening, candidate relationship management, ATS, and recruiting technology skills; experience leveraging AI-enabled recruiting tools is a plus.
Highly professional, collaborative, organized, and relationship-driven, with the ability to work onsite in downtown Boston every Tuesday and Wednesday from 9:00 a.m.-5:00 p.m.
